Output 3abdc1350418ca4cfad567eadf973b8e29a8f4e2a612d11a040c91b6c602f653:1

value
19837405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 774ccf2aaa30b7800059a8df8daef8b43c5ba48c OP_EQUAL
address
3CZpMAu3ciwx52Qew7Khu5UZicp6LcrKh8
transaction
3abdc1350418ca4cfad567eadf973b8e29a8f4e2a612d11a040c91b6c602f653
confirmations
344385
spent
true